## Step 4: Migrate the Alert Deduplicator

Move the dedup service from Quillon v1 to v2. Fingerprinting now hashes the full label set, so duplicate suppression windows behave differently. Security note: the v2 config is read-only at runtime and loaded from a mounted secret. Verify the suppression window and hash salt rotation before sign-off. Deploy v2 with the following configuration values.

deployment values, yafop-tahof:
HOLIX_HOST=holix.zemvarsys.internal
HOLIX_PORT=3306

Quick note on reads: Pebblekeep sits behind a bloom filter, so most lookups for keys that don't exist get rejected before ever touching the store. False positives happen (about 1%), so a filter pass doesn't guarantee the key exists — always handle the not-found case. Contractors query the filter stats endpoint to check saturation. That endpoint requires the internal Pebblekeep service key, shown below.

service key, bajep-hahig: zpat15_8GdlyV2kd9BCqYH

### Step 4: Configure the Nightscribe Scheduler

Nightscribe replaces the old cron wrapper for nightly backfills on the Marlon data platform. Each backfill job is declared in the scheduler manifest with a window, concurrency cap, and retry policy. New team members should copy the staging manifest before editing. Apply the following baseline configuration before enabling any jobs.

settings of tajep-yahif:
[praion]
team = praax
access_code = ac_2cf0e2
owner = istox.aldmir
host = praion.lumicsoft.local
port = 9090
peer = aldax.qorvelcloud.local
salt = c327c8e8
pin = 1997

For the new folks: we run permessage-deflate on the Relaygrid fanout tier, but it's a tradeoff, not a win. CPU on the edge boxes climbs ~18% under compression; bandwidth drops ~40% for chatty dashboards. Small frames (<256B) skip compression entirely — don't "fix" that. Marisol tuned the window bits after the Q2 incident; changing them invalidates client context takeover assumptions. If latency p99 creeps, disable compression per-channel before touching pool sizes. Current settings for the tier are as follows.

service settings:
[casax]
port = 6379
team = rusir
host = casax.zemvarhq.corp
region = outer-4
access_code = ac_9808ce
timeout_ms = 1500